MURS140 - MURS160 PRV : 400 - 600 Volts Io : 1.0 Ampere FEATURES : * High current capability * High surge current capability * High reliability * Low reverse current * Low forward voltage drop * Ultra Fast Recovery Time * Pb / RoHS Free SURFACE MOUNT ULTRA FAST RECTIFIERS SMB (DO-214AA) 1.1 ± 0.3 5.4 ± 0.15 4.8 ± 0.15 2.0 ± 0.1 3.6 ± 0.15 2.3 ± 0.2 0.22 ± 0.07 MECHANICAL DATA : * Case : SMB Molded plastic * Epoxy : UL94V-O rate flame retardant * Lead : Lead Formed for Surface Mount * Polarity : Color band denotes cathode end * Mounting position : Any * Weight : 0.093 gram Dimensions in millimeter Rating at 25 °C ambient temperature unless otherwise specified. Single phase, half wave, 60 Hz, resistive or inductive load. For capacitive load, derate current by 20%.
